/* Copyright (c) 1985 Ceriel J.H. Jacobs */
/*
* Terminal handling routines, mostly initializing.
*/
# ifndef lint
static char rcsid[] = "$Header$";
# endif
# define _TERM_
#include "in_all.h"
#include "term.h"
#include "machine.h"
#include "output.h"
#include "display.h"
#include "options.h"
#include "getline.h"
#include "keys.h"
#include "main.h"
#ifdef TIOCGWINSZ
static struct winsize w;
#endif
char *strcpy(),
*strcat(),
*tgoto(),
*tgetstr(),
*getenv();
static char tcbuf1[1024]; /* Holds terminal capability strings */
static char * ptc; /* Pointer in it */
static char tcbuf[1024]; /* Another termcap buffer */
short ospeed; /* Needed for tputs() */
char PC; /* Needed for tputs() */
char * UP; /* Needed for tgoto() */
static char *ll;
struct linelist _X[100]; /* 100 is enough ? */
# if USG_TTY
static struct termio _tty,_svtty;
# elif POSIX_TTY
static struct termios _tty, _svtty;
# else
# ifdef TIOCSPGRP
static int proc_id, saved_pgrpid;
# endif
static struct sgttyb _tty,_svtty;
# ifdef TIOCGETC
static struct tchars _ttyc, _svttyc;
# endif
# ifdef TIOCGLTC
static int line_discipline;
static struct ltchars _lttyc, _svlttyc;
# endif
# endif
static VOID
handle(c) char *c; { /* if character *c is used, set it to undefined */
if (isused(*c)) *c = 0377;
}
/*
* Set terminal in cbreak mode.
* Also check if tabs need expanding.
*/
VOID
inittty() {
# if USG_TTY
register struct termio *p = &_tty;
ioctl(0,TCGETA,(char *) p);
_svtty = *p;
if (p->c_oflag & TAB3) {
/*
* We do tab expansion ourselves
*/
expandtabs = 1;
}
p->c_oflag &= ~(TAB3|OCRNL|ONLRET|ONLCR);
p->c_oflag |= (/*ONOCR|*/OPOST); /* ONOCR does not seem to work
very well in combination with
~ONLCR
*/
p->c_lflag &= ~(ECHO|ECHOE|ECHOK|ECHONL|ICANON);
if (isused('S'&037) || isused('Q'&037)) p->c_iflag &= ~IXON;
handle(&(p->c_cc[0])); /* INTR and QUIT (mnemonics not defined ??) */
handle(&(p->c_cc[1]));
erasech = p->c_cc[VERASE];
killch = p->c_cc[VKILL];
p->c_cc[VMIN] = 1; /* Just wait for one character */
p->c_cc[VTIME] = 0;
ospeed = p->c_cflag & CBAUD;
ioctl(0,TCSETAW,(char *) p);
#elif POSIX_TTY
register struct termios *p = &_tty;
tcgetattr(0, p);
_svtty = *p;
#ifdef _MINIX /* Should be XTABS */
if (p->c_oflag & XTABS) {
/*
* We do tab expansion ourselves
*/
expandtabs = 1;
}
p->c_oflag &= (OPOST|XTABS);
#else
p->c_oflag &= ~OPOST;
#endif
p->c_lflag &= ~(ECHO|ECHOE|ECHOK|ECHONL|ICANON);
if (isused('S'&037) || isused('Q'&037)) p->c_iflag &= ~IXON;
handle(&(p->c_cc[VINTR]));
handle(&(p->c_cc[VQUIT]));
erasech = p->c_cc[VERASE];
killch = p->c_cc[VKILL];
p->c_cc[VMIN] = 1; /* Just wait for one character */
p->c_cc[VTIME] = 0;
ospeed = cfgetospeed(p);
tcsetattr(0, TCSANOW, p);
# else
register struct sgttyb *p = &_tty;
# ifdef TIOCSPGRP
/*
* If we can, we put yap in another process group, and the terminal
* with it. This is done, so that interrupts given by the user
* will only affect yap and not it's children (processes writing
* on a pipe to yap)
*/
if (ioctl(0, TIOCSPGRP, (char *) &proc_id) != -1) {
setpgrp(0, proc_id);
}
# endif
ioctl(0,TIOCGETP,(char *) p);
_svtty = *p;
erasech = p->sg_erase;
killch = p->sg_kill;
ospeed = p->sg_ospeed;
if (p->sg_flags & XTABS) {
/*
* We do tab expansion ourselves
*/
expandtabs = 1;
}
p->sg_flags |= (CBREAK);
p->sg_flags &= ~(ECHO|XTABS|RAW|LCASE|CRMOD);
#ifdef TIOCSETN
ioctl(0, TIOCSETN, (char *) p);
#else
ioctl(0,TIOCSETP,(char *) p);
#endif
/* Bloody Sun ... */
#undef t_startc
#undef t_stopc
#undef t_intrc
#undef t_quitc
#undef t_suspc
#undef t_dsuspc
#undef t_flushc
#undef t_lnextc
# ifdef TIOCGETC
{ register struct tchars *q = &_ttyc;
ioctl(0,TIOCGETC,(char *) q);
_svttyc = *q;
handle(&(q->t_intrc));
handle(&(q->t_quitc));
if (isused(q->t_startc) || isused(q->t_stopc)) {
q->t_startc = q->t_stopc = 0377;
}
ioctl(0,TIOCSETC, (char *) q);
}
# endif
# ifdef TIOCGLTC
{ register struct ltchars *q = &_lttyc;
ioctl(0,TIOCGETD,(char *) &line_discipline);
if (line_discipline == NTTYDISC) {
ioctl(0, TIOCGLTC,(char *) q);
_svlttyc = *q;
handle(&(q->t_suspc));
handle(&(q->t_dsuspc));
q->t_flushc = q->t_lnextc = 0377;
ioctl(0,TIOCSLTC, (char *) q);
}
}
# endif
# endif
}
/*
* Reset the terminal to its original state
*/
VOID
resettty() {
# if USG_TTY
ioctl(0,TCSETAW,(char *) &_svtty);
# elif POSIX_TTY
tcsetattr(0, TCSANOW, &_svtty);
# else
# ifdef TIOCSPGRP
ioctl(0, TIOCSPGRP, (char *) &saved_pgrpid);
setpgrp(0, saved_pgrpid);
# endif
ioctl(0,TIOCSETP,(char *) &_svtty);
# ifdef TIOCGETC
ioctl(0,TIOCSETC, (char *) &_svttyc);
# endif
# ifdef TIOCGLTC
if (line_discipline == NTTYDISC) ioctl(0,TIOCSLTC, (char *) &_svlttyc);
# endif
# endif
putline(TE);
flush();
}
/*
* Get terminal capability "cap".
* If not present, return an empty string.
*/
STATIC char *
getcap(cap) char *cap; {
register char *s;
s = tgetstr(cap, &ptc);
if (!s) return "";
return s;
}
/*
* Initialize some terminal-dependent stuff.
*/
VOID
ini_terminal() {
register char * s;
register struct linelist *lp, *lp1;
register i;
register UG, SG;
char tempbuf[20];
char *mb, *mh, *mr; /* attributes */
initkeys();
#if !_MINIX
# ifdef TIOCSPGRP
proc_id = getpid();
ioctl(0,TIOCGPGRP, (char *) &saved_pgrpid);
# endif
#endif
inittty();
stupid = 1;
ptc = tcbuf1;
BC = "\b";
TA = "\t";
if (!(s = getenv("TERM"))) s = "dumb";
if (tgetent(tcbuf, s) <= 0) {
panic("No termcap entry");
}
stupid = 0;
hardcopy = tgetflag("hc"); /* Hard copy terminal?*/
PC = *(getcap("pc"));
if (*(s = getcap("bc"))) {
/*
* Backspace if not ^H
*/
BC = s;
}
UP = getcap("up"); /* move up a line */
CE = getcap("ce"); /* clear to end of line */
CL = getcap("cl"); /* clear screen */
if (!*CL) cflag = 1;
TI = getcap("ti"); /* Initialization for CM */
TE = getcap("te"); /* end for CM */
CM = getcap("cm"); /* cursor addressing */
SR = getcap("sr"); /* scroll reverse */
AL = getcap("al"); /* Insert line */
SO = getcap("so"); /* standout */
SE = getcap("se"); /* standend */
SG = tgetnum("sg"); /* blanks left by SO, SE */
if (SG < 0) SG = 0;
US = getcap("us"); /* underline */
UE = getcap("ue"); /* end underline */
UG = tgetnum("ug"); /* blanks left by US, UE */
if (UG < 0) UG = 0;
UC = getcap("uc"); /* underline a character */
mb = getcap("mb"); /* blinking attribute */
MD = getcap("md"); /* bold attribute */
ME = getcap("me"); /* turn off attributes */
mh = getcap("mh"); /* half bright attribute */
mr = getcap("mr"); /* reversed video attribute */
if (!nflag) {
/*
* Recognize special strings
*/
(VOID) addstring(SO,SG,&sppat);
(VOID) addstring(SE,SG,&sppat);
(VOID) addstring(US,UG,&sppat);
(VOID) addstring(UE,UG,&sppat);
(VOID) addstring(mb,0,&sppat);
(VOID) addstring(MD,0,&sppat);
(VOID) addstring(ME,0,&sppat);
(VOID) addstring(mh,0,&sppat);
(VOID) addstring(mr,0,&sppat);
if (*UC) {
(VOID) strcpy(tempbuf,BC);
(VOID) strcat(tempbuf,UC);
(VOID) addstring(tempbuf,0,&sppat);
}
}
if (UG > 0 || uflag) {
US = "";
UE = "";
}
if (*US || uflag) UC = "";
COLS = tgetnum("co"); /* columns on page */
i = tgetnum("li"); /* Lines on page */
AM = tgetflag("am"); /* terminal wraps automatically? */
XN = tgetflag("xn"); /* and then ignores next newline? */
DB = tgetflag("db"); /* terminal retains lines below */
if (!*(s = getcap("ho")) && *CM) {
s = tgoto(CM,0,0); /* Another way of getting home */
}
if ((!*CE && !*AL) || !*s || hardcopy) {
cflag = stupid = 1;
}
(VOID) strcpy(HO,s);
if (*(s = getcap("ta"))) {
/*
* Tab (other than ^I or padding)
*/
TA = s;
}
if (!*(ll = getcap("ll")) && *CM && i > 0) {
/*
* Lower left hand corner
*/
(VOID) strcpy(BO, tgoto(CM,0,i-1));
}
else (VOID) strcpy(BO, ll);
if (COLS <= 0 || COLS > 256) {
if ((unsigned) COLS >= 65409) {
/* SUN bug */
COLS &= 0xffff;
COLS -= (65409 - 128);
}
if (COLS <= 0 || COLS > 256) COLS = 80;
}
if (i <= 0) {
i = 24;
cflag = stupid = 1;
}
LINES = i;
maxpagesize = i - 1;
scrollsize = maxpagesize / 2;
if (scrollsize <= 0) scrollsize = 1;
if (!pagesize || pagesize >= i) {
pagesize = maxpagesize;
}
/*
* The next part does not really belong here, but there it is ...
* Initialize a circular list for the screenlines.
*/
scr_info.tail = lp = _X;
lp1 = lp + (100 - 1);
for (; lp <= lp1; lp++) {
/*
* Circular doubly linked list
*/
lp->next = lp + 1;
lp->prev = lp - 1;
}
lp1->next = scr_info.tail;
lp1->next->prev = lp1;
if (stupid) {
(VOID) strcpy(BO,"\r\n");
}
putline(TI);
window();
}
/*
* Place cursor at start of line n.
*/
VOID
mgoto(n) register n; {
if (n == 0) home();
else if (n == maxpagesize && *BO) bottom();
else if (*CM) {
/*
* Cursor addressing
*/
tputs(tgoto(CM,0,n),1,fputch);
}
else if (*BO && *UP && n >= (maxpagesize >> 1)) {
/*
* Bottom and then up
*/
bottom();
while (n++ < maxpagesize) putline(UP);
}
else { /* Home, and then down */
home();
while (n--) putline("\r\n");
}
}
/*
* Clear bottom line
*/
VOID
clrbline() {
if (stupid) {
putline("\r\n");
return;
}
bottom();
if (*CE) {
/*
* We can clear to end of line
*/
clrtoeol();
return;
}
# ifdef VT100_PATCH
insert_line(maxpagesize);
# else
insert_line();
# endif
}
# ifdef VT100_PATCH
ins_line(l) {
tputs(tgoto(AL, l, 0), maxpagesize - l, fputch);
}
# endif
VOID
home() {
tputs(HO,1,fputch);
}
VOID
bottom() {
tputs(BO,1,fputch);
if (!*BO) mgoto(maxpagesize);
}
int
window()
{
#ifdef TIOCGWINSZ
if (ioctl(1, TIOCGWINSZ, &w) < 0) return 0;
if (w.ws_col == 0) w.ws_col = COLS;
if (w.ws_row == 0) w.ws_row = LINES;
if (w.ws_col != COLS || w.ws_row != LINES) {
COLS = w.ws_col;
LINES = w.ws_row;
maxpagesize = LINES - 1;
pagesize = maxpagesize;
if (! *ll) (VOID) strcpy(BO, tgoto(CM,0,maxpagesize));
scr_info.currentpos = 0;
scrollsize = maxpagesize / 2;
if (scrollsize <= 0) scrollsize = 1;
return 1;
}
#endif
return 0;
}
